Ultrasonic Distance Measurement Usages
Ultrasonic distance sensors furnish a multifunctional technique for gauging distances in broad settings. These appliances employ ultrasonic waves to determine the length it takes for a pulse beat to return from a target. This readings is subsequently evaluated to determine the gap between the receiver and the subject.
- Machine Automation heavily employs ultrasonic sensors for barrier avoidance, navigation, and material management.
- Patient Monitoring adopt ultrasonic distance sensors in patient tracking, delivering consistent measurements.
Also, ultrasonic distance sensors are used in parking assistance to reinforce features such as presence sensing. Their flexibility makes them an key asset across varied markets.

Choosing out the Proper Ultrasonic Sensor: A Tutorial for Engineers
Ultrasonic sensors supply a hands-free way for assessing distances and registering objects. Diverse factors influence the selection of an ultrasonic sensor, making it vital for engineers to understand the individual specifications of their application. To start, analyze the required range. Sensors are available with multiple coverage areas, from a few centimeters to several meters. Next, analyze the ambient environment. Factors like temperature, humidity, and the presence of dust or debris can affect sensor functionality. Opt for a sensor that is constructed to handle these settings. Another necessary consideration is the specified accuracy. Some sensors provide high precision, automotive ultrasonic sensors while others are more appropriate for less critical applications. Lastly, consider the communication protocol to ensure compatibility with your framework.
